LINUX.ORG.RU

POSTGRESQL - тормозит !!!!!!!


0

0

Hi all Не подскажет ли кто как оптимизировать Postgresql - проблема вот в чем - есть БД примерно на 2 милиионов записей + 4-5 табличек - так вот при запросах тяжелых postgresql начинает немеренно расти в памяти хавая все подрят - если задать 3-4 таких запроса одновремено - то приходится минут через 10 стопать PostgreSQL .... Есть ли у кого какие предположения на этот счет - пробовал вроде бы все переводить на mysql - но там такая же картина .... Можно ли чтобы PostgreSQL забрал бы себе допустим 50% от общей памяти и потом в них "мирно и тихо работал"- как делают большие БД типа Oracle ? Вот из бесплатных БД вроде подвернулась еще firebird/interbase - вот думаю на ней попробовать - интересно картина улучшится ?

anonymous

Re: POSTGRESQL - тормозит !!!!!!!

Interbase тебе точно не поможет. Он на количестве записей больше млн. просто загибается:(

anonymous ()

Re: POSTGRESQL - тормозит !!!!!!!

Лучше бы ты эти свои "тяжелые" запросы оптимизировал, а не с базы на базу прыгал.

anonymous ()

Re: POSTGRESQL - тормозит !!!!!!!

Из бесплатных сейчас есть еще SapDB - попробуй там.
В sybase есть ограничение на размер выделяемой памяти точно.
А оптимизировать запрос - это частное решение, я думаю.....

neshura ()

Re: POSTGRESQL - тормозит !!!!!!!

а как у нас дела обстоят с индексами? любое потенциально поисковое поле должно иметь индекс да и запрос, который возвращает хотя бы 10000 строк - нах он такой нужен? нужно ограничивать ползователям максимальные объемы запросов и предлагать добавлять дополнительные критерии

anonymous ()

Re: POSTGRESQL - тормозит !!!!!!!

Попробуй поиграть параметром -B в опциях postmaster

anonymous ()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.